WebDec 4, 2024 · A CHRO, or Chief Human Resources Officer, is responsible for all HR-related functions within an organization. This includes overseeing recruitment and hiring, employee benefits, training and development, and compliance with labor laws. WebHistorically, as important as chief financial officers (CFOs) or chief marketing officers (CMOs) were to businesses, they were still seen as “staff functions”—more administrative than strategic, more to serve the business than to drive it. The chief human resources officer (CHRO) role was no different in this regard. Web5 Common Chief Human Resources Officer Interview Questions & Answers.
